Facet Joint Dysfunction

Facet joint syndrome is an arthritis-like condition of the spine that can be a significant source of back pain.

https://centerforpainrelief.com/wp-content/uploads/2022/05/cervicogenic-headaches-yellow-1500-1250.png

Cervicogenic Headaches

A cervicogenic headache presents as unilateral pain that starts in the neck, and produces chronic headaches.

https://centerforpainrelief.com/wp-content/uploads/2022/05/spinal-stenosis-yellow-1500-1250.png

Cervical Spinal Stenosis

Cervical stenosis is a condition in which the spinal canal is too small for the spinal cord and nerve roots.

https://centerforpainrelief.com/wp-content/uploads/2022/04/trigemial-neualgia.png

Trigeminal Neuralgia

Trigeminal neuralgia is a condition that causes painful sensations similar to an electric shock on one side of the face.

https://centerforpainrelief.com/wp-content/uploads/2022/04/occipital-blocks.png

Occipital
Neuralgia

Occipital neuralgia is a type of headache characterized by piercing, throbbing, or electric-shock-like chronic pain.

https://centerforpainrelief.com/wp-content/uploads/2022/04/Herniated-disc.png

Herniated
Disc

Sometimes called a slipped or ruptured disk, a herniated disk often causes nerve impingement and shooting pain.

Do You Have Chronic Headaches or Migraines?BOTOX® for Chronic Migraines

Botox® is an FDA-approved medication for use as a treatment for chronic migraine. Chronic migraine is defined as having at least 15 headache
days a month, with at least eight of those featuring migraine symptoms.
